The Age of Adz (pronounced "The Age of Odds") is the sixth studio LP by American singer-songwriter and multi-instrumentalist Sufjan Stevens.Released on October 12, 2010, Adz was Stevens' first official studio album after 2005's Illinois launched him into the indie spotlight (though in the interim he had put out an album’s worth of Cut Songs from Illinois, five discs of Christmas music, an orchestral suite, a string quartet reimagining of an earlier LP, an hour-long EP, and various covers, so it's safe to say he wasn’t resting on his laurels).While many fans hoped Stevens' new album would be another installment in the so-called "Fifty States Project", following up both Illinois and 2003's Michigan, Adz came with no geographical concept and instead focused on, in Stevens' words, "my physical body, my feelings, touch, the nerves, anxiety, the chemistry of the brain and the spinal fluid" in the wake of a severe and unexplained illness which had caused him to cancel a tour the previous year.Even more surprisingly, Adz was a New Sound Album which replaced Stevens' signature banjo-led indie folk and Baroque Pop with dense, manic, and occasionally autotune-inflected electronica. While Stevens had experimented with synth-led music in the past—his second LP, Enjoy Your Rabbit, was an instrumental glitch album—he'd become best known and loved for what he once referred to as "strummy-strum acoustic guitar songs". The unexpected sonic shift startled fans and critics alike, and to this day, Adz remains one of his most divisive albums.In keeping with the album's more-personal-than-usual tone, Stevens' lyrics on Adz are also more confessional and less story-driven than his earlier work tended to be. Notably, the album includes Stevens' longest song to date, the 25-minute-plus "Impossible Soul", as well as his first-ever lyrical use of profanity—many times—in "I Want to Be Well".While writing the album, Stevens was deeply influenced by Louisiana-based outsider artist "Prophet" Royal Robertson, whose apocalyptic paintings fuse imagery from the Bible, sci-fi films, and Robertson's own schizophrenic visions. One of Robertson's pieces was adapted into the cover art for Adz, and the song "Get Real Get Right" is based on the artist's life and work.Tracklist: "Futile Devices" (2:11) "Too Much" (6:44) "Age of Adz" (8:00) "I Walked" (5:01) "Now That I'm Older" (4:56) "Get Real Get Right" (5:10) "Bad Communication" (2:24) "Vesuvius" (5:26) "All for Myself" (2:55) "I Want to Be Well" (6:27) "Impossible Soul" (25:35) note On the vinyl version, the last three-minute section of "Impossible Soul" is placed just after "I Want to Be Well" on side C, while the rest of the song makes up the entirety of side D. | |

Darker and Edgier: Even by Sufjan's usual standards, the lyrics on The Age of Adz deal a lot with difficult emotions and personal themes including death, disease, illness, anxiety, and suicide. This is also the first Sufjan release to feature profanity (and a lot of it, too, though it's confined to one track), and many listeners find the style much less pleasant and accessible than his other releases. | |

Epic Rocking: At 25:35, "Impossible Soul" is Sufjan's longest track to date, beating out "Djohariah" by a good 8+ minutes. It's so long, in fact, that the vinyl version has to break the song apart (with the last section moved to the beginning, on a separate side of the disc) in order for everything to fit. Most of the songs qualify to some extent. There are only three tracks on the album under 4:30, and "Age of Adz" is 8:00 on the dot. | |

Rearrange the Song: The vinyl release moves the last section of "Impossible Soul" to the beginning. Though done in the interest of space, this also gives the song a slightly more ambiguous and unsettling ending. "Futile Devices" was remixed by Sufjan's sometimes-producer Doveman (aka Thomas Bartlett) for use on the Call Me by Your Name soundtrack, where it appears alongside two film-exclusive Sufjan tracks. | |

Ambiguously Bi: An even more prevalent theme here than on most Sufjan releases. Some songs address men romantically ("Futile Devices", "All for Myself"), some address women ("Now That I'm Older", "Impossible Soul"), and some could go both ways ("I Walked", "Bad Communication", "Impossible Soul"). Lyrical Dissonance: The Title Track culminates in a soaring, triumphant crescendo of horns and electronics, with the lyrics "I've lost the will to fight / I was not made for life." "I Want to Be Well" is an upbeat, uptempo song whose narrator suffers from an unspecified—and possibly deadly—illness. | |
